WebDeer can be excluded from areas with a properly constructed and maintained 6 to 8-foot high fence. The higher fence will be needed in an area with many deer and a low supply of wild food. A board fence or hedge that prevents deer from seeing a safe landing zone on the other side need be only 5 1/2 feet high. Can Deer swim underwater? Yes, some species of deer can swim underwater. But not all species of deer can do that. WebMay 7, 2024 · 4. Limit Space Between Posts. Deer can exert a lot of pressure on fencing, so avoid spreading the posts too far apart, which puts more pressure on the fence itself (the weakest link) rather than on the sturdy posts. It also increases the likelihood that the fence will sag in between posts and encourage deer to jump over.
